Crystal structure of adenylate kinase from Methanococcus maripaludis
Experimental procedure
Experimental method | SINGLE WAVELENGTH |
Source type | ROTATING ANODE |
Source details | RIGAKU RUH3R |
Temperature [K] | 103 |
Detector technology | IMAGE PLATE |
Collection date | 2008-08-28 |
Detector | RIGAKU RAXIS IV |
Wavelength(s) | 1.54 |
Spacegroup name | H 3 |
Unit cell lengths | 102.840, 102.840, 228.720 |
Unit cell angles | 90.00, 90.00, 120.00 |
Refinement procedure
Resolution | 19.700 - 2.500 |
R-factor | 0.18821 |
Rwork | 0.183 |
R-free | 0.23911 |
Structure solution method | MOLECULAR REPLACEMENT |
Starting model (for MR) | 1kht |
RMSD bond length | 0.022 |
RMSD bond angle | 2.151 |
Data reduction software | d*TREK |
Data scaling software | d*TREK |
Phasing software | PHASER (for MR) |
Refinement software | PHENIX (5.5.0070) |
Data quality characteristics
Overall | Outer shell | |
Low resolution limit [Å] | 29.690 | 2.590 |
High resolution limit [Å] | 2.500 | 2.500 |
Rmerge | 0.082 | 0.330 |
Number of reflections | 31158 | |
<I/σ(I)> | 9.6 | 2.3 |
Completeness [%] | 99.9 | 100 |
Redundancy | 2.44 | 2.4 |
Crystallization Conditions
crystal ID | method | pH | temperature | details |
1 | VAPOR DIFFUSION, SITTING DROP | 4.7 | 273 | 3.4 M ammonium chloride, 0.1 M sodium acetate, 3% ethylene glycol (v/v)., pH 4.7, VAPOR DIFFUSION, SITTING DROP, temperature 273K |
